PET Bottle Washing Line: A Complete Manual
Wiki Article
A modern recycling plant represents a crucial stage in the recycling of post-consumer PET containers. This detailed guide examines the multiple aspects of these systems, encompassing everything from initial cleaning and warm washing, to disinfection and concluding cleaning . The full operation generally involves removing labels , residues, and any remaining debris to prepare the bottles for further processing and reclamation . Understanding the function of each segment – moving belts, scrubbers, and drying apparatus – is necessary for optimal operation and superior output.
Boosting Plastic Recycling: Pelletizing Machine Solutions
To effectively resolve the growing issue of plastic waste, innovative recycling techniques are vital. Pelletizing machines present a powerful solution by transforming rejected plastic into valuable, standardized pellets. These pellets, readily processed, are able to be used as raw material for fresh plastic items, substantially reducing reliance on petroleum and minimizing environmental damage. Here's how pelletizing machines are making a contribution :
- Enhanced Material Quality : Pelletizing creates consistently sized pellets, ideal for production processes.
- Lowered Transportation Expenses : Pellets are denser than bulky plastic scrap , resulting in lower transport costs.
- Increased Recycling Options : Pelletizing permits the recycling of a broader range of plastic types .
The adoption of pelletizing equipment represents a key step towards a sustainable and closed-loop plastic market.

Optimizing Plastic Film Washing Line Efficiency
To boost the output of your plastic wrap washing line , a thorough review is vital. Numerous factors affect total efficiency . Consider implementing a tiered method. First , confirm sufficient initial cleaning to lessen the load on the core washing equipment . Afterward , fine-tune liquid force and temperature – greater settings can frequently boost purification, but should be balanced to preclude damage to the plastic . Furthermore , periodic servicing of the rinsing units is paramount to prevent downtime .
- Review nozzles for blockages .
- Purge reservoirs routinely .
- Renew worn components .
